By Salma Khalik Senior Health Correspondent






HEALTH Minister Gan Kim Yong has instructed public hospitals to "do everything possible" to make patients comfortable and "ensure their safety" even as they face a severe shortage of beds.

Having seen the growing demand for hospital care some years ago, he stressed yesterday that the Government has begun building more hospitals, with 1,200 beds to be added later this year.

In the meantime, "we are actively working to tackle the current crunch in a few public hospitals" he said, by sending patients to other public hospitals with available beds, and discharging them to community hospitals when possible.

Yesterday, Mount Elizabeth Novena offered to lend 60 beds to public hospitals to help relieve the space crunch. Alternatively, it said, it could take in that many patients to be cared for by its own medical team.


Mount Elizabeth Novena Hospital has offered to lend 60 beds to public hospitals to help ease the bed crunch. Alternatively, it said, it could take in that many patients to be cared for by its own medical team. -- ST FILE PHOTO



<!-- /.view -->

Explaining how the new upmarket private hospital has spare capacity as it is not fully opened yet, chief executive Kelvin Loh said: "We're always open to private-public cooperation."

He added that fees will be reasonable as"the intention is to help meet the high demand".

The offer comes after a Straits Times report yesterday highlighting the severe shortage of beds at several public hospitals.

Tan Tock Seng Hospital (TTSH), Changi General Hospital (CGH) and Khoo Teck Puat Hospital (KTPH) experienced more than 92 per cent bed occupancy last week, on the back of very high rates in the past year.

That means there were days when occupancy crossed the 100 per cent mark, forcing CGH, for instance, to start housing some patients in a tent this week.

Dr Loh said private hospitals usually aim for occupancy rates of 70 per cent to 75 per cent, as special beds in intensive care and isolation units, for instance, must always be kept available for emergencies.

If occupancy rates cross 80 per cent, "it means that on peak days we could cross 100 per cent and our responsiveness will be affected". "That's not acceptable in a private hospital."

Two other hospitals in the Parkway Pantai group, to which Mount Elizabeth Novena belongs, already have link-ups with the public sector. CGH rents a ward from Parkway East, while also sending some of its dengue patients to Gleneagles Hospital.

"I think the Ministry of Health should be open to all options which can help alleviate the current situation," said the chairman of the Government Parliamentary Committee for Health, Dr Lam Pin Min, when told about Mount Elizabeth Novena's offer. He added that he will raise the subject when Parliament next sits on Jan 20.

The hospital most likely to benefit is TTSH as it is just across the road from Mount Elizabeth Novena. It has already set up temporary beds, complete with privacy curtains, along the corridors of its wards to deal with its bed crunch.

Nearly 30 patients are using these "corridor beds".

The bed crunch is also affecting the National University Hospital (NUH), with 89 per cent occupancy last week.

[h=2]Gan: I’ve asked hospitals to make patients comfortable[/h]

Health Minister Gan Kim Yong

In response to media reports that hospitals are now housing patients in tents and corridors (‘SG hospitals house patients in corridors & tents‘), the Minsitry of Health (MOH) said yesterday (8 Jan) that they are tackling the bed crunch in several ways.
MOH said that over 1,200 beds will be added this year, comprising acute, intermediate and long-term care capacity.
Hospitals are also looking after patients in their homes and community.
Several hospitals have started transitional care to help patients transit home smoothly, which facilitates timely discharge.
Some hospitals refer patients to “interim caregivers”, who provide comprehensive personal care to patients post-discharge, if they lack support at home.
Other hospitals have started a programme to help frail patients who have a history of frequent re-admissions control and improve their condition. This is to help patients stay out of hospital.
Community hospitals run by voluntary welfare organisations have also partnered public hospitals to accept patients who do not require acute hospital care.
Minister for Health Gan Kim Yong said:
We have seen the trend of a steady increase in demand for healthcare services and have already planned for new hospitals, community hospitals and nursing homes a few years ago. However, this will take time to build. For example, the new Ng Teng Fong Hospital will be ready by the end of the year.
Right now, we are actively working to tackle the current crunch in a few public hospitals, such as tapping available bed capacity in other public hospitals, as well as facilitating the timely discharge of patients to available beds in the community hospitals, or with the help of home care providers.
Mr Gan has instructed public hospitals to “do everything possible” to make patients comfortable and “ensure their safety” even as they face a severe shortage of beds.
The population in Singapore has been increasing rapidly especially over the last few years. Last year, it hit 5.4 million, according to the Department of Statistics (DOS):

However, despite the advanced “planning” which Mr Gan claimed took place a few years ago, supply simply could not keep up with demand, resulting in the current situation of hospitals resorting to tents and corridors to accommodate their patients.
If the planning had been that good a few years ago, surely Singaporeans now do not need to stay in makeshift tents and corridors while they are treated.
khaw_Boon_Wan-300x200.jpg
Previous Health Minister Khaw Boon Wan

Mr Khaw Boon Wan, the previous Minister for Health even boasted in 2010 during the opening of the Khoo Teck Puat Hospital (KTPH) that Singapore would not be caught out by a shortage of hospital beds ever again [Link]:
Mr Khaw said that Singapore will not be caught out by a shortage of hospital beds again.
The building of Jurong General Hospital will start this year. The hospital, slated to have about 700 beds, should open before 2015.
Although Alexandra Hospital will then be closed and its 300 beds taken out of the system, there will still be a net increase of about 400 beds.
A site in the Sengkang-Punggol area, which has a growing population, has been reserved for yet another new hospital.
But as things have turned out, even KTPH now has to resort to sending patients to Alexandra Hospital because it too, could not cope with the demand for hospital beds.

Singapore is not a member of OECD. Singapore’s hospital bed density can be derived from DOS [Link]:

As one can see, Singapore’s number of hospital beds per 1,000 people actually decreased from 2007 to 2012, dropping from 2.5 to 2.2, primarily due to a burgeoning increase in population (15.8% from 2007 to 2012) versus a small increase in the number of hospital beds (just 2.7% from 2007 to 2012).
